322321 发表于 2016-10-13 10:21:55

ELK-ElasticSearch集群索引分配异常问题处理

ES索引分片问题:
突然有一天发现es索引分片只能在集群中的一台服务器上。另外一台服务器没有索引分片。

查看es日志发现,提示有因为磁盘利用率处在一个high watermark 所以索引分片不能分配到该节点。


1
2
3
high disk watermark exceeded on free: 39gb, shards will be relocated away from this node
low disk watermark exceeded on free: 52.9gb, replicas will not be assigned to this node
low disk watermark exceeded on free: 52.9gb, replicas will not be assigned to this node




清理历史日志后,集群节点索引分片开始重新路由分配,日志如下:


1
rerouting shards:





重新路由碎片:[一个或多个节点已经在高或低水位下]

由日志提示可以看出,集群中的任何节点处在高水位上,高水位下,都会进行索引分配的重新路由。
页: [1]
查看完整版本: ELK-ElasticSearch集群索引分配异常问题处理